10a. Come join Journei Bimwala to learn about wild foraging, plant identification, and how to be in reciprocity with our food ecosystem. Journei is a clinical herbalist, foraging practitioner, and educator who has been teaching communities how to identify edible and medicinal plants since 2014 across New York City and the tri-state area. She is a founding member of the Bronx River Foodway and an invaluable voice for food sovereignty, self empowerment and alternative pathways of abundance. 11a Join Holes in the Wall Collective in person for the scavenger hunt, guiding you through the history of Concrete Plant Park and the visions of the future. 12p Live offering from world renowned spoken word artist La Bruja in collective thanks to the waters, trees, plants and people. Caridad De la Luz, aka LA BRUJA, is an Emmy-winning poet, indigenous activist, Bronx living legend and current Executive Director of the Nuyorican Poets Cafe. Made in partnership with Holes in the Wall Collective and Bronx River Alliance This is part of Imagined Futures: This Must be the Place scavenger hunt, connecting you deeper to 7 waterways across the city.
